Output 73d580b8a226087558f84b784d75de74e68854237163485ca7bf0e6c0d0fb227:1

value
21541
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 496173e289341e2e6e4194a41180ce73d7c35f8e OP_EQUALVERIFY OP_CHECKSIG
address
17h158nVpj9A85DuD3dokeMUtoJpUicvPX
transaction
73d580b8a226087558f84b784d75de74e68854237163485ca7bf0e6c0d0fb227
spent
true